RECRUIT.ED LIMITED is seeking an experienced TIG Welder/Fabricator to join our team in Hailsham, East Sussex. This full-time, permanent role involves TIG welding and fabrication of vacuum chambers and components, maintaining high-quality standards and production timelines.

The ideal candidate will have at least 3 years of TIG welding experience and the ability to read engineering drawings.

We offer a stable and progressive working environment with flexible shifts and excellent working conditions.
